Crafting great SaaS user experience design

In the competitive landscape of software as a service (SaaS), a well-executed user experience is no longer a luxury but a fundamental requirement for success. It acts as the bridge between powerful features and genuine user satisfaction, directly impacting adoption rates, customer retention, and overall business growth. A product with fantastic capabilities but a frustrating interface will struggle to gain traction, whereas a product that is intuitive, efficient, and a pleasure to use can build a loyal user base even with fewer bells and whistles. Paying close attention to how users interact with a SaaS application from their very first click through their ongoing daily tasks is paramount.

The Power of Simplicity in Apple’s Storytelling

Apple’s brand storytelling isn’t about bombarding you with technical specs. Instead, it’s about crafting a feeling, a sense of effortless elegance and intuitive design. They focus on the emotional connection between the user and the product, showcasing how it seamlessly integrates into daily life and enhances it. This minimalist approach, emphasizing the “what it does for you” rather than the “how it does it,” creates a powerful and lasting impression.

Humanizing Technology Through Authentic Storytelling

Apple masterfully humanizes technology by showcasing real people using their products in real-life scenarios. Their commercials and marketing materials often feature diverse individuals, from musicians to photographers to everyday families, demonstrating how Apple products empower them to pursue their passions and connect with others. This authentic portrayal resonates with audiences because it transcends the technical aspects, focusing instead on the human experience.
